Finding Acorralada with Verified English Subtitles: Your Ultimate Streaming Guide
For fans of classic telenovelas, few titles evoke as much drama, passion, and betrayal as Acorralada ("Trapped"). Originally broadcast in 2007, this Venevisión-produced mega-hit starring Alejandra Lazcano, David Zepeda, and Sonya Smith remains a staple of Latin American television. However, for non-Spanish speakers or those learning the language, finding Acorralada with verified, high-quality English subtitles can feel like navigating a maze of broken links and sketchy streaming sites.
